Maintenance Electrician - Newcastle, Tyne & Wear Β£38,000 overtime van Provide Planned and Reactive Electrical Maintenance across multiple sites & sectors Deliver Planned Preventative Maintenance, Reactive Repairs and Installation works across various asset types such as but not limited to: Lighting systems Electrical Distribution Boards & Associated Circuits Fire & Intruder Alarm systems Pumps, Motors and associated Control systems Building Management Systems PAT Testing HVAC systems EV systems Fault finding and repairs on electrical equipment & systems Carry out alterations, installations and electrical testing in accordance with specification and legislation Responding promptly and positively to reactive call requests from our Helpdesk Team Provide On-call Service as part of a call-out rota Compilation of quotes for installation & repairs works; specifically outlining the quantities of materials and labour times required Identify non-repairable issues and promptly advise the Contract Manager of findings and recommendations Required to travel to various locations in order to fulfil their allocated task Follow instructions from Line Manager regarding scheme and scope of works Personal Specification NVQ Level 3, AM2, City & Guilds 2391 Inspection & Testing Previous experience in Electrical Maintenance & Installation Ability to maintain and repair a range of electrical systems to recognised standards whilst working with minimum supervision Ability to repair and maintain a range of equipment Application of their vocational experience to the benefit of the business Ability to use own initiative, working accurately with policies and procedures Prioritise workload and meet deadlines Good written and verbal communication skills PC literate Full Diving License Customer focused Self-motivated and flexible in your approach to work Good problem-solving skills Work carried out to a high-quality standard Benefits: Company car, lots of overtime available
